
Crunchy, smoky, and deeply satisfying, these roasted chickpeas hit that snack-food craving without a single animal product in sight. The real secret to getting them genuinely crispy — not just toasted — is the thorough drying step before they ever hit the oven, which draws out surface moisture so the heat can work its magic. A bold spice blend of turmeric, cumin, smoked paprika, and garlic powder goes on partway through roasting, so the flavors bloom in the oven rather than burning off too early. That two-stage roasting method means you end up with chickpeas that are deep golden and audibly crisp, with no sad, chewy centers to ruin the batch. They keep crisping as they cool on the rack, so patience pays off here. Toss them into salads, pile them on grain bowls, or just eat them straight off the pan — they disappear fast either way.

Preheat the oven to 400°F (205°C). Spread the drained chickpeas in a single layer on a clean kitchen towel or several layers of paper towels and pat them thoroughly dry — press firmly to remove as much surface moisture as possible. Let them air-dry for 5 minutes while the oven heats.
Transfer the dried chickpeas to a rimmed baking sheet. Drizzle with the olive oil and toss to coat evenly. Spread in a single layer with space between the chickpeas.
